[Iranian Official Reveals US-Iran Memorandum Draft: Open Strait, US Unfreezes Assets, Waives Oil Sanctions]
According to Reuters, as cited by Jin10, a senior Iranian official stated that under the memorandum draft reached with the United States, Tehran has agreed neither to produce nor acquire nuclear weapons. The US, in the memorandum draft, agreed that Tehran would dilute its stockpile of highly enriched uranium within Iran, with specific mechanisms to be discussed over the next 60 days.
Under the memorandum draft, the US will waive oil sanctions on Iran within a specified timeframe, allowing Iran to sell oil and generate revenue. Iran will immediately reopen the Strait of Hormuz to all merchant ships, while the US will lift the maritime blockade. The US has agreed to release $25 billion of Iran's frozen assets, with the release methods including direct cash transfers, regional cooperation, and financial credit lines.
Before reaching a final agreement, Iran has agreed to maintain the nuclear status quo, including refraining from uranium enrichment activities and not expanding nuclear facilities. The US has agreed not to impose any new sanctions on Iran before a final agreement is reached.
